Ludhiana, Jan. 31 -- A high-level review meeting to assess environmental compliance and finalise Ludhiana's District Environment Plan was convened on Saturday at Punjab Agricultural University (PAU), chaired by Afroz Ahmad, member and judge of the National Green Tribunal (NGT), New Delhi.
Senior officials from the municipal corporation, Ludhiana, Punjab Pollution Control Board (PPCB), health department, district administration and other stakeholder departments attended the meeting. The deliberations focused on adherence to NGT judgments and directives regarding the formulation and implementation of the District Environment Plan.
